While Dolan isn't referenced by name, his lawyer confirmed that he is the person mentioned. Dolan is also a former executive director of the Democratic Governors Association who advised Hillary Clinton's 2008 presidential campaign and volunteered for her 2016 campaign. The indictment stated that to get surveillance warrants for former Trump campaign aide Carter Page, the FBI used significant resources in trying to corroborate the dossier and depended on it heavily.Īdditionally, the indictment stated that Danchenko was given information by Charles Dolan Jr., a Democratic donor and activist. The document was funded by Democrats who also included scandalous allegations about former President Donald Trump's conduct in Russia and about ties between the country and the Trump campaign. Prosecutors told the judge they will be in the discovery phase now, and hope to soon share the information they find with the defense.ĭanchenko was a primary source for the "Steele dossier," a report put together by former British spy Christopher Steele.
